Interoperability in Action:
Real-time tracking GPS trackers are designed with open architecture and standard protocols, enabling smooth integration with a wide range of systems and software platforms. This interoperability opens up a myriad of possibilities for users to leverage tracking data across different applications and workflows. Here's how integration can be achieved:
1. API (Application Programming Interface) Integration: Many real-time tracking GPS trackers provide APIs that allow developers to integrate tracking data into custom applications or third-party software platforms. APIs facilitate seamless communication and data exchange, enabling users to incorporate tracking information into their existing workflows.
2. Fleet Management Systems: Integration with fleet management systems is particularly beneficial for businesses with vehicle fleets. Real-time tracking GPS trackers can feed location data directly into fleet management software, providing fleet managers with comprehensive visibility and control over their assets.
3. Enterprise Resource Planning (ERP) Systems: Integration with ERP systems enables businesses to synchronize tracking data with their core business processes such as inventory management, supply chain logistics, and resource allocation. This integration enhances operational efficiency and streamlines decision-making processes.
4. Business Intelligence (BI) Tools: Real-time tracking GPS trackers can integrate with BI tools to enrich analytics and reporting capabilities. By combining tracking data with other datasets, businesses can gain deeper insights into performance metrics, customer behavior, and market trends.

Practical Considerations:
When considering integration options for real-time tracking GPS trackers, it's essential to evaluate compatibility, security, and data privacy considerations. Here are some practical considerations:
- Compatibility: Ensure that the tracking platform supports the necessary integration protocols and standards required by the target systems or software platforms.
- Security: Implement robust security measures to protect sensitive tracking data during transmission and storage. Encryption, authentication, and access controls are essential safeguards against unauthorized access or data breaches.
- Data Privacy: Adhere to data privacy regulations and best practices to safeguard the privacy rights of individuals whose data is being tracked. Obtain consent where required and implement data anonymization techniques to mitigate privacy risks.
